MDC Alliance condemned for rowdy behaviour

by Zivanai Dhewa

The disorderly and disruptive behaviour exhibited by the Movement for Democratic Change Alliance, (MDC-A) in the August House has been roundly condemned by all and Sundry.

The opposition legislators heckled and booed at the Chief Justice, Luke Malaba, Zimbabwe Electoral Commission Chairperson, Priscillah Chigumba and the re-elected Speaker of the House of Assembly, Advocate Jacob Mudenda.

Having observed behaviour of incitement within the MDC A, Independent House of Assembly for Norton, Temba Mliswa took to his Twitter handle and urged the leader of the MDC A, Nelson Chamisa to advise his MPs to desist from unruly behaviour.

“@Nelsonchamisa should instruct that an apology is made if he is serious.  One hopes he didn’t incite such behaviour,” tweeted Mliswa.

 Advocate Mudenda was re-elected the Speaker of the House of Assembly. He beat MDC Alliance’s nominee, Paurina Mupariwa. Adv Mudenda’s deputy is Tsitsi Gezi. 

Zanu PF boss for women’s league, Mabel Chinomona was elected the Senate President and  she is deputised by retired Lieutenant General, Mike Nyambuya. Cde Chinomona beat MDC Alliance’s Morgen Komichi.

Pupurai Togarepi is now the new Zanu PF Chief Whip and his deputy is Tendai Muzenda.
